The regulatory status of a forex broker is one of the most critical factors that determine its legitimacy. SmartFXGlobal claims to operate under the supervision of the Vanuatu Financial Services Commission (VFSC). However, the credibility of this claim is questionable, as many brokers operating under VFSC are often considered less reliable compared to those regulated by more stringent authorities like the FCA in the UK or ASIC in Australia.
Regulatory Authority | License Number | Regulatory Region | Verification Status |
---|---|---|---|
Vanuatu Financial Services Commission (VFSC) | 40491 | Vanuatu | Suspicious clone |
The VFSC has a reputation for being lenient in its regulatory requirements, which raises concerns regarding the overall safety and security of funds deposited with SmartFXGlobal. Furthermore, various reviews suggest that SmartFXGlobal may not be fully compliant with the regulatory standards that protect investors, such as maintaining segregated accounts for client funds. This lack of regulatory oversight raises red flags about the broker's operations and its commitment to safeguarding client investments.
SmartFXGlobal is operated by Smart Securities and Commodities Limited, which is registered in Vanuatu. The company was established in 2018, and while it claims to have a solid operational foundation, there is limited publicly available information regarding its ownership structure and management team. The anonymity surrounding the ownership and the lack of transparency in its operations can be concerning for potential investors.
The management teams qualifications and experience are crucial indicators of a broker's reliability. However, SmartFXGlobal does not provide detailed information about its leadership, which limits the ability to assess their expertise in the financial sector. Furthermore, the absence of clear information on the company's website regarding its operational history and regulatory compliance raises questions about its transparency and accountability.
SmartFXGlobal presents a variety of trading conditions, but the details regarding fees and commissions are often vague. The platform claims to offer competitive spreads and low trading costs, but many user reviews indicate otherwise.
Fee Type | SmartFXGlobal | Industry Average |
---|---|---|
Spread on Major Currency Pairs | 1.7 pips | 1.2 pips |
Commission Structure | $20 per standard lot | $0 - $10 per standard lot |
Overnight Interest Range | Varies | Varies |
The spread on major currency pairs like EUR/USD is reported to be higher than the industry average, which could significantly affect trading profitability. Additionally, the commission structure is not competitive compared to other brokers, which typically charge lower or no commissions on trades. This discrepancy in trading costs may deter cost-conscious traders and signal underlying issues with the broker's pricing model.
Safety of client funds is paramount in the forex trading industry. SmartFXGlobal claims to implement various measures to protect client investments, including segregated accounts. However, the effectiveness of these measures is questionable given the broker's regulatory status.
The absence of negative balance protection is another concern, as this means traders could potentially lose more than their initial investment. Additionally, there have been reports of delayed withdrawals and issues with accessing funds, which further exacerbate concerns regarding the safety of client funds. Historical disputes involving fund security at SmartFXGlobal have not been well-documented, but the lack of transparency in this area is alarming.

The trading platform offered by SmartFXGlobal is based on MetaTrader 5 (MT5), a widely recognized platform known for its advanced features. However, user experiences regarding platform stability and execution quality are varied. Some users report smooth execution and a user-friendly interface, while others have encountered issues with slippage and order rejections.
The quality of order execution is critical for traders, especially in a fast-paced market. Reports of slippage during high volatility periods can be concerning, as they suggest that traders may not receive the expected prices for their trades.
